How early should I arrive for an Amtrak train?

The recommended arrival time for each stationvaries, but plan to arrive at least 30 minutes prior to yourscheduled departure. If you need help with baggage, tickets or anyother services, or if you are departing from a large or busystation, we recommend you arrive at the station evenearlier.

Subsequently, question is, can you bring your own food and drink on Amtrak? You may bring your own food and beveragesonboard for consumption at your seat or privateSleeping Car accommodations. However, you can only consumefood and beverages purchased in Dining and Lounge Cars inthose cars. Personal food and beverages are allowed in theupper level of Superliner Sightseer Lounges.

Are seats assigned on Amtrak?

Seats are automatically assigned uponreservation. To select a preferred seat, customers cansimply modify their assigned seat at any time prior toboarding at Amtrak.com, through Amtrak's mobile appor with a ticket agent. There are no fees to choose or modify aseat assignment.

Do I need to print my Amtrak ticket?

Once purchased, you'll get an email with theticket attached as a PDF. Smartphone users can simplyshow that e-ticket to the conductor, who can thenscan it. If you don't have a smartphone, you canprint the ticket at home or at a kiosk in the station.Will you use an e-ticket to travel onAmtrak?

Can I bring alcohol on Amtrak?

Alcohol. Amtrak sells alcoholicbeverages on its trains, but if you're particularly partial to aspecific wine, beer or liquor, you're permitted to boardwith the drink and consume it during your trip. You can't,however, consume your own alcohol in public areas of thetrain.

Are there bullet trains in America?

Japan's bullet trains can reach nearly 200 milesper hour and date to the 1960s. But the U.S. has no truehigh-speed trains, aside from sections of Amtrak's Acelaline in the Northeast Corridor. The Acela can reach 150 mph foronly 34 miles of its 457-mile span.

What is the fastest train in the United States?

Amtrak's Acela Express is America's fastesttrain, yet its average speed is only 68 mph on the trip betweenBoston and Washington, D.C. The train does hit 150 mph alonga few stretches of straight track, but that hardly warrants the tagbullet train.

How many bags can you carry on Amtrak?

Each passenger may bring two personal items, 25 lbs. (12kg) and 14 x 11 x 7 inches each, and two carry-on items, 50lbs. (23 kg) and 28 x 22 x 14 inches each, onboard. Make sureyou have a tag with your name and address on the outside ofall your bags.
